About the Symposium

ASQ® Around the World is an invitation-only, one-of-a-kind opportunity to share advances in developmental screening. Invited attendees will talk with Jane Squires, Diane Bricker, and other ASQ developers; share important ASQ research with others; and exchange information, ideas, and innovations.

Participation Options:

Invited attendees can participate through one or both of the following: (1) presenting a poster or (2) giving a 30- or 60-minute presentation. Check out the presentation highlights from the 4th Symposium here!

Topics:

  • Cultural and linguistic adaptations
  • Developing norms for different populations
  • Implementation practices and follow-up
  • Family engagement, including culturally inclusive practices
  • Developing a system for online screening

Cost:

There is no registration fee for attending the Symposium as a presenter. Attendees are responsible for their own travel costs, including airfare and accommodation.

Length:

The Symposium begins on Friday evening (September 5), runs all day Saturday (September 6), and ends with a half day on Sunday (September 7).

Language:

The Symposium will be presented in English. Attendees are welcome to register a colleague to come with them for translation assistance or working reference.

Other Invitees

In addition to ASQ co-developers Jane Squires and Diane Bricker, other guests at this year’s Symposium will include researchers, childhood development professionals, and ASQ publishers from many countries, including Australia, Brazil, Canada, China, Chile, Croatia, Denmark, Germany, Saudi Arabia, South Korea, Singapore, Taiwan, the Netherlands, and more.
